Full Job Posting
About the Role
- We're looking for a detail oriented and analytical Quantity Surveyor to join our infrastructure maintenance team in Dubai, United Arab Emirates.
- In this role, you will be responsible for managing costs, preparing accurate measurements, and ensuring efficient budget control throughout the lifecycle of infrastructure maintenance projects.
- The ideal candidate will demonstrate strong organizational skills, meticulous attention to detail, and the ability to work effectively with cross functional teams to deliver projects on time and within budget.
Key Responsibilities
- Prepare and analyze bills of quantities (BoQ) for infrastructure maintenance projects with precision and accuracy.
- Conduct detailed cost estimation, forecasting, and budget analysis to support project planning and financial control.
- Monitor project expenditures and provide regular cost reports to project management and stakeholders.
- Manage contract administration, including variations, claims, and change orders in accordance with contract terms.
- Perform quantity measurements and valuations based on project specifications and industry standards.
- Maintain comprehensive project documentation, records, and cost databases for audit and reference purposes.
- Analyze supplier quotations and negotiate pricing to optimize procurement costs.
- Identify and assess financial risks associated with projects and recommend mitigation strategies.
- Collaborate with project managers, engineers, and contractors to ensure accurate cost tracking and reporting.
- Ensure compliance with UAE construction regulations, standards, and organizational policies.
- Prepare progress reports and financial statements for management review and decision making.
What do we need from you
- Minimum 3 5 years of professional experience as a Quantity Surveyor or in a similar cost management role.
- Proven experience in infrastructure maintenance projects or related construction environments.
- Strong expertise in cost estimation, budget management, and financial forecasting.
- Proficiency with quantity surveying software and tools (e.g., Bluebeam, Touchplan, or equivalent).
- Advanced pro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ite, particularly Excel and Project.
- Solid understanding of construction contracts, procurement practices, and contract administration.
- Knowledge of UAE construction regulations, standards, and local building codes.
- Familiarity with CAD software and ERP systems (preferred).
- Excellent analytical and problem solving skills with strong attention to detail.
- Exceptional organizational and time management abilities.
- Strong written and verbal communication skills in English.
- Ability to work independently and collaboratively within a team environment.
